
.brand {
        font-size: 12pt;
        color: white;
}

.navbar-text{
	font-size: 14pt;

}

.btn {
    white-space: normal; // allows for wrapping long texts

}

.tag {
    font-size: 8pt;
    background-color: #ddc;
    padding: 4px;
    margin: 5px;
    border-radius: 5px;
}

#albumButton {
    margin-bottom: 10pt;
}

.directory-photo{
    padding: 5px;
}

.containerr {

    padding: 10px 10px 10px 10px;
	border-radius: 10px;

	background-color: #fafafa;
}

.container-directory {

	width: 200px;

	margin-left : auto;
	margin-right: auto;

	text-align : center;
	font-size: 20pt;

	line-height: 30pt;
	padding : 20px;
	margin: 20px;

    align:center;
    background: #f0f0f0;

}

.container-photo {
    border: 5px;
    padding: 15px 15px 15px 15px;
    margin-bottom: 20pt;
    background: #eeeeee;

    border-radius: 10px;
}

.img-responsive {
    margin: 0 auto;
}

.photo-caption {
	text-align : left;
	#width : 600px;

	margin-left : auto;
	margin-right: auto;

	line-height: 16pt;
	font-size: 8pt;
	background-color: #dedede;

    border-radius: 4px;
    padding-left: 5px;

}

.photo-description {
	text-align : left;
	#width : 600px;
	margin-left : auto;
	margin-right: auto;

	margin-top : 15pt;
	margin-bottom: 15pt;
	line-height: 16pt;
	font-family : Arial;
}

.photo {
	#height : auto;
	#width : 600px;

	background-color : #aad;

	border-radius: 4px;
}

.play-store-link {
    height : 35px;
}

.navbar-text {
    margin : 10px;
}

.grid-item {
  float: left;
    width: 200px;
  border-radius: 4px;
}

.footer {
    margin-top:40px;
    padding:10px;
    background-color: #114;
}